PRAGUE, Czechia, 30 August–1 September 2026— Europe Congress is pleased to announce the successful conclusion of the 2026 edition of Events Club Forum, which took place from 30 August–1 September in Prague, Czechia. This unique MICE forum consistently connects top-level international event planners with carefully selected MICE service providers from across Europe year after year.

Over 2.5 immersive days of networking and destination discovery, participants attended match-made, oneto-one B2B meetings, networking events at major MICE venues across the city, and destination-focused activities designed to showcase the best of Prague, while immersing themselves in Czechia’s historic capital on city tours and site inspections.

The event featured two dinner evenings hosted at some of Prague’s biggest event venues—the upscale Hilton Prague, which boasts one of Europe’s largest conference facilities and stunning views of the Vltava River; and Maj House of Fun, a multi-story venue with a rooftop bar, panoramic views of Prague, and floors of arcade games, shops, and cafés.

The event brought together 200+ selected participants from across Europe, the US, and Asia. Through a unique combination of exhibition and one-on-one meetings, event planners had the chance to meet with 130+ suppliers based on the regions and services they were most interested in. Networking lunches, city tours, and coffee breaks provided extended opportunities for collaboration.

Five sightseeing tours organized by Czech Convention Bureau showcased the best of Prague and provided an introduction to the city’s history through a walking tour of Prague Castle and Lobkowicz Palace; a Czech beer masterclass with Pilsner, where participants learned from professional brewers and bartenders; a tasting of local Czech specialties and regional products; an e-bike tour of Prague’s panoramic viewpoints; and a walking tour following the sculptures of famous Czech artist David Černý, followed by a tasting of the Czech liquor, Slivovitz.

For the fifth consecutive year, Events Club Forum was hosted at Prague Congress Centre, the top congress center in Czechia, which hosted over 200 events per year. Considered the most beautiful city in the world, centrally located in Europe with easy flight connections around the world, and full of history, varied event spaces, and nightlife, Prague proved yet again to be an ideal setting for events of all sizes.
